Consumer Narrative

I am filing this complaint because my credit reports with TransUnion and XXXX contain multiple negative items that I believe are inaccurate, outdated, or improperly reported under the Fair Credit Reporting Act ( FCRA, 15 U.S.C. 1681 et seq. ) and the Fair Debt Collection Practices Act ( FDCPA, 15 U.S.C. 1692 et seq. ). As of XX/XX/XXXX, my reports show a payment history of only 88 % on-time, with XXXX late payments reported across multiple closed and open accounts. Several of these accounts, including XXXXXXXX XXXX XXXX XXXX XXXX XXXX XXXX XXXX and XXXX are closed but still show multiple missed payments ( ranging from XXXX to XXXX ). I believe some of these late marks are either duplicate, outdated, or should have been updated when the accounts closed, per FCRA 1681c. In addition, I have an active credit card account with XXXX XXXX XXXX XXXX that is currently reporting as over the credit limit ( 103 % utilization ). This has a significant negative impact on my credit standing. I have made payments and asked the creditor to update this balance accurately, but it has not been properly updated, which may violate FCRA 1681s-2 ( b ) if the furnisher fails to report current information. I also have an account with XXXX XXXX that is currently marked as late, despite my efforts to bring it current and communicate with the lender. My report includes two active collections : XXXX XXXX XXXX XXXX ( {$1300.00}, opened XX/XX/XXXXXXXX ) and XXXX XXXX XXXX ( {$1500.00}, opened XX/XX/XXXXXXXX ). I have repeatedly asked these collectors to validate these debts as required by FDCPA 809 ( b ), but I have not received sufficient documentation. I believe they continue to report these balances in violation of my rights under the FDCPA. Furthermore, my reports show multiple hard inquiries in a short period XXXX XXXX XXXX XXXX XXXX XXXX XXXX XXXX XXXX XXXX XXXX XXXX XXXX XXXX XXXX XXXX XXXX XXXX XXXX XXXX XXXX XXXX XXXX XXXX XXXX XXXX XXXX XXXX XXXX XXXX XXXX XXXX XXXX XXXX XXXX XXXX XXXX XXXX XXXX XXXXXX/XX/XXXX ). I believe some of these were either not fully authorized or not clearly disclosed to me at the time they were made, which may violate FCRA 1681b ( c ). I have made multiple attempts to resolve these matters directly with the furnishers, debt collectors, and the credit bureaus by disputing the late payments, requesting removal or validation of collections, disputing unauthorized inquiries, and requesting that my utilization be reported correctly. However, these issues remain unresolved. I am providing supporting documentation, including screenshots of my credit report summaries, payment histories, utilization percentages, collections details, and the list of inquiries. I respectfully request that the CFPB investigate these matters, compel the involved parties to : 1 ) Fully verify or remove any inaccurate, unverifiable, or obsolete information per FCRA 1681i ( a ). 2 ) Ensure accurate updating of my account balances and payment history per FCRA 1681s-2. 3 ) Remove any hard inquiries that can not be verified as properly authorized. 4 ) Require debt collectors to provide proper validation or remove the collections per FDCPA 809 ( b ). This situation has caused significant harm to my credit score ( currently XXXX TransUnion, XXXX XXXX ) and limits my fair access to credit and financial opportunities. I am seeking a fair resolution to have my reports corrected, updated, or cleared of unverifiable negative items and to receive written confirmation of all corrections as required by federal law.
